Frequently Asked Questions

Area Conversion FAQ

How many square feet are in an acre?

1 acre = 43,560 square feet. This is the standard US land measurement used in real estate and agriculture. An acre is roughly the size of a football field without the end zones.

How do you convert square feet to square meters?

Multiply square feet by 0.092903. For example, 1,000 sq ft × 0.092903 = 92.9 m². You can also divide by 10.764 to get the same result.

How many square meters are in a hectare?

1 hectare = 10,000 square meters. Hectares are the standard land unit in metric countries and are widely used in agriculture, forestry, and international real estate.

What is the difference between an acre and a hectare?

1 hectare = 2.471 acres. Acres are used primarily in the US and UK for land measurement; hectares are the metric equivalent used internationally. For large farm or land areas, knowing both conversions is essential for international transactions.

How many acres are in a square mile?

1 square mile = 640 acres = 259 hectares. Square miles are commonly used for large geographic regions, counties, and national parks in the United States.

How do I convert square meters to square feet?

Multiply square meters by 10.7639. For example, 100 m² × 10.7639 = 1,076.4 sq ft. This conversion is frequently needed when comparing international property listings with US real estate.

Essential Area Conversion Factors & Formulas

Metric System Conversions

1 square meter = 10,000 square centimeters = 1,000,000 square millimeters. For larger areas: 1 hectare = 10,000 square meters = 2.471 acres. The metric system's decimal base makes calculations straightforward for scientific and engineering applications.

Imperial System Conversions

1 square foot = 144 square inches. 1 square yard = 9 square feet. For land measurement: 1 acre = 43,560 square feet = 4,840 square yards. These units remain standard in US real estate, construction, and agriculture.

Cross-System Conversions

1 square meter = 10.764 square feet exactly. 1 acre = 0.4047 hectares. 1 square mile = 640 acres = 259 hectares. These conversions are essential for international projects and global real estate transactions.

Professional Applications of Area Measurements

  • Real Estate & Property: Property listings, floor plans, lot sizes, and zoning calculations require precise area measurements. Residential properties typically use square feet, while commercial real estate may use square meters or acres depending on location.
  • Construction & Architecture: Material estimates, coverage calculations, and building permits require accurate area measurements. Flooring, roofing, and paint coverage are calculated per square foot or square meter, with waste factors added for practical projects.
  • Agriculture & Land Management: Farm planning, crop yields, irrigation coverage, and land valuation use acres or hectares. Precision agriculture relies on GPS mapping to calculate exact field areas for optimal resource allocation and yield prediction.
  • Manufacturing & Design: Surface area calculations for coatings, material usage optimization, and packaging design. Electronics manufacturing uses square millimeters for circuit boards, while textile production calculates fabric areas in square meters or yards.
  • Environmental & Scientific: Habitat assessment, pollution monitoring, solar panel installations, and research plots require precise area measurements. Environmental impact studies calculate affected areas in hectares or square kilometers for comprehensive analysis.

Area Measurement Best Practices & Professional Tips

  • Irregular Shape Calculations: Break complex areas into simple rectangles, triangles, and circles. Use the grid method for highly irregular shapes, or employ digital tools like CAD software for precise calculations. Always account for excluded areas like columns or fixed fixtures.
  • Surveying and GPS Technology: Professional land surveys use theodolites and GPS for sub-meter accuracy. Consumer GPS units typically have 3-5 meter accuracy, suitable for general area estimation but not legal property boundaries. Always verify with professional surveys for legal documents.
  • Material Coverage Calculations: Add 5-10% waste factor for rectangular rooms, 10-15% for complex layouts. Paint coverage varies by surface texture and application method. Flooring materials have different waste factors: hardwood 5-7%, tile 10-15%, carpet 5-10%.
  • Digital Measurement Tools: Laser measuring devices, smartphone apps with AR measurement, and satellite imagery provide quick area estimates. Professional drone surveys offer high-accuracy mapping for large areas with centimeter-level precision for construction and agriculture.
  • Legal and Regulatory Considerations: Building codes specify minimum room sizes, lot coverage ratios, and setback requirements. Agricultural subsidies and tax assessments depend on accurately reported acreage. Always use certified measurements for legal documents and official applications.
